POLICE are hunting thieves who made off with a lifeline mobility scooter.

The navy blue scooter, which had been left to its current owner by their late father, was stolen from Crabwood Road in Maybush.

It was later found abandoned with significant damage to the central control panel.

The incident happened between 7am on February 7 and 1.20am on February 8.

Now the police are calling for anyone with any information to come forward.

Police Constable Steve Antrobus said: “The scooter has been found by the owner with significant damage and this has caused a great deal of distress due to the sentimental value of the vehicle, as it belonged to his late father.

“Did you see anyone acting suspiciously around the time of the theft? We have issued a photograph of the scooter – did you see anyone with this blue mobility scooter in the area?”
